What is candidiasis?
Yeast infection caused by candida albicans fungus; women have vulva irritation, inflammation, itching and discharge; men are symptom-free
What is trichomoniasis?
Caused by trichimonas vaginalis protozoan
What is bacterial vaginosis?
Caused by a bacteria overgrowth in combination with other microorganisms
What is urethritis?
Infection of the urethra

What are the stages of syphilis?
First stage:
- A syphilitic chancre as it appears on the labia, penis, mouth
Second stage:
- Skin rash all over body
Third stage:
- Disease goes into remission, but if left untreated, can be fatal

What is cervicitis?
Inflammation of the cervix
What is endometritis?
Inflammation of the lining of the uterus
What is salpingitis?
Inflammation of the fallopian tubes
What is nongonococcal urethritis?
Inflammation of the urethra
What is PID (Pelvic inflammatory disease)?
- 750,000 cases in US each year
